Defect relation of $n+1$ components through the GCD method

Min Ru and Julie Tzu-Yueh Wang

Vol. 338 (2025), No. 2, 349–371
Abstract

We study the defect relation through the GCD method. In particular, among other results, we extend the defect relation result of Chen, Huynh, Sun and Xie (2025) to moving targets. The truncated defect relation is also studied. Furthermore, we obtain the degeneracy locus, which can be determined effectively and is independent of the maps under the consideration.
